The Yamaha AT1 was a 125cc, 2-stroke, dual-purpose motorcycle manufactured by Yamaha from 1970 through 1972.
The AT1 had a raised rear fender but no raised front fender, a raised exhaust, handlebars with cross members, universal tires, and adequate ground clearance for an off-road-enduro motorcycle or trail motorcycle.
